Title: **Tsuneo Kondo: Innovator in Steel Flow Control Technologies**
Introduction
Tsuneo Kondo is an esteemed inventor based in Tokyo, Japan, recognized for his significant contributions to the field of molten steel flow control. With a total of five patents to his name, Kondo's innovations have played a crucial role in enhancing steel manufacturing processes, particularly in continuous casting methods.
Latest Patents
Among Tsuneo Kondo's latest inventions is the **Apparatus for Controlling Flow of Molten Steel in Mold**. This apparatus features a casting-condition acquiring unit that collects at least five casting conditions, a calculating unit for determining the molten steel flow velocity based on those conditions, and a determining unit that assesses the flow velocity against a critical threshold. Additionally, it includes a control unit that utilizes a shifting magnetic field to optimize the discharge flow and facilitate the horizontal rotation of molten steel.
Another notable patent is the **Method for Controlling Flow of Molten Steel in Mold**, which outlines techniques for managing molten steel flow velocity in a slab continuous casting machine. This method enables the controlled adjustment of flow velocity to predetermined levels by applying a shifting magnetic field, thereby ensuring a consistent quality of cast products.
Career Highlights
Tsuneo Kondo's career has been marked by his tenure at leading companies in the steel industry. He has worked at JFE Steel Corporation and JFE Refractories Corporation, where he has developed and implemented innovative solutions that drive efficiency and quality in steel production.
Collaborations
Throughout his career, Kondo has collaborated with notable colleagues, including Jun Kubota and Seishi Mizuoka. Their joint efforts have contributed to advancements in technologies related to molten steel flow control and have influenced the broader steel manufacturing landscape.
